2016 Guastaferro - Taurasi DOCG Primum (750ml)
Bred for extended aging, the 2016 Guastaferro Taurasi DOCG Primum channels Campanian volcanic soil directly into a structured 100 percent Aglianico built for medium‑to‑long term cellaring. Sourced from roughly seven hectares across Piano d’Angelo at 350 meters elevation, the fruit originates from pre‑phylloxera vines and grafted rootstock growing in mineral‑rich volcanic ash. These geographic conditions produce exceptional acid retention and phenolic depth.
Fermented without temperature control in stainless steel vessels alongside fifteen‑day maceration periods, the wine matures for twelve months in large neutral barrels before resting eight additional months in bottle. This measured timeline preserves primary fruit clarity while building a firm internal architecture that rewards patience.
Tasting Profile
A deep ruby core highlights dark cherry, violet blossoms, forest mushroom, and cured tobacco on the nose. Secondary layers emerge as black licorice and warm baking spice. The palate delivers substantial body and dense concentration anchored by fine‑grained tannins and vibrant acidity, resolving into a persistent mineral finish.
